commercial printing / commercial print shops

Akzidenz can not be translated into English. It goes back to Gutenberg. In general English distinguishes between publication, commercial, packaging. Akzidenz is a bit of commercial, a bit of publication and a bit of posterwork. The best translation (and the one used in English source texts) would be commercial printing, even though this term does not fully cover the German "Akzidenzdruck".

Some ideas

I'm not an expert in printing terminology, so all I can do is offer some terms listed in my library science dico.
Akzidenzdruck = jobbing printing, jobbing work, job printing.
Akzidenzsatz = job composition
Akzidenzschrift = display type
Akzidenztype = jobbing type

Akzidenz
Druck- und Satzarbeit mit geringem Umfang (Anzeigen, Formulare, Briefbögen) Quelle: Typografie professionell
http://www.galileodesign.de/glossar/gp/anzeige-7801

Akzidenzen
Gelegenheitsdrucksachen wie Geschäftspapiere, Visitenkarten, Familiendrucksachen, Wurfzettel, Briefbögen, kleine Prospekte usw., im Gegensatz zu Büchern, Zeitungen, Zeitschriften, Katalogen oder anderen Periodika.
